Subject: Quickstore 4.2 — bloom filter now fronts the KV layer

Plugin authors: starting with this release, Quickstore places a bloom filter ahead of the key-value store. Negative lookups return faster; false positives fall through safely. No API changes are required on your side. Verify your plugin against the staging build referenced below.

session token of fahif-tadup = htk3_9c7

## The Greywick lint baseline

Hey, welcome aboard. The file `baseline.lint.json` at the repo root is a frozen list of pre-existing static-analysis findings in Greywick — stuff we've agreed to ignore for now. Your job is to never add to it. If your change trips a new warning, fix the code, don't edit the baseline. Shrinking it is always welcome, though; delete entries as you clean things up and mention it in your PR. When regenerating, use the pinned analyzer version recorded in the token below.

pipeline stamp: htk6_35e0c9

## Service Accounts — Torchlane Session Refresh Bug

Quick note for release: the token-refresh bug in Torchlane 3.8 was caused by the `session-refresher` service account caching stale grants. The fix clears the grant cache on rotation. Verify in staging before cutting the release. The staging refresher authenticates to the internal auth service with the key below.

API key for yahig-tadup: kto7_ubizbYm